Course Content

• Introduction to Augmented Reality (AR) and its Applications in Disaster Response
• AR for Situational Awareness and Damage Assessment (using drones and mobile AR)
• 3D Modeling and Reconstruction for Disaster Recovery using AR
• Geospatial Data Integration and Visualization in AR for Disaster Management
• Developing AR Applications for Emergency Response and Evacuation Planning
• AR-based Training and Simulation for Disaster Preparedness
• Ethical Considerations and Privacy in AR for Disaster Relief
• Case Studies: Successful AR Deployments in Disaster Recovery

Career path

UK Augmented Reality (AR) for Disaster Recovery Job Market: Key Roles

Role Description
AR Disaster Response Specialist Develops and deploys AR applications for real-time disaster assessment and response coordination, leveraging location data and 3D modeling for improved situational awareness. Strong AR development skills (e.g., Unity, ARKit, ARCore) are essential.
AR Data Analyst for Emergency Management Analyzes large datasets from various sources (sensors, drones, satellite imagery) to create AR visualizations for emergency responders. Proficiency in data analysis and visualization techniques coupled with AR development skills is critical.
AR Training and Simulation Developer (Emergency Services) Creates immersive AR training simulations for emergency personnel, focusing on disaster response scenarios and operational procedures. Experience in game development and instructional design is beneficial.
